St George-Illawarra Dragons vs Wests Tigers

WIN Stadium – Friday 7th June – 8pm (AEST)

Match Preview

The Dragons were victorious last week over a weakened Panthers outfit, capturing a much-needed victory. While doubts remain about the quality of their opponent, fact is that they headed into that match as outsiders; few gave them a hope of performing well and that noise only grew louder as their trailed 10-nil at HT. A paint-stripping spray from coach Flanagan refocussed the team and they produced a superior second half display to score 22 unanswered points. The weight of possession (55%) and high completion rate (80%) swung momentum in their favour; they also made almost 400m more and had over 600 PCM’s compared to the Panthers 444. Their positive momentum with the ball meant they made 8 line breaks. They were a strong defensive side also, only missing 25 tackles for the match. Such a standard, albeit against weaker opposition, should be maintained if they want to push their way into the Top 8. 

The Tigers had a week off following their Round 12 42-28 loss to the Cowboys in Townsville. The scoreline suggests that it was a one-sided contest, but the Tigers were brave at certain times, and while not ever close enough to win, will take confidence from that performance. They gave themselves every possible opportunity with an 81% completion rate, 9.1m per carry and 5 line breaks. They were let down defensively though, allowing 10 line breaks and missing 44 tackles. Such shortcomings highlight the inconsistencies plaguing their chances of success; it must improve should they want to climb higher on the competition ladder. 

Match Prediction

It is expected that Hunt Su’A and Lomax will back up for the Dragons on Friday. If they do, it will swing momentum in their favour. Hunt is especially crucial to his team’s success. The Tigers are boosted by the return of Olam and Naden to the edges and will take a fresh team into this game with no players backing up from Origin. Players like Utoikamanu and Koroisau should head into this game with a point to prove after being overlooked for Wednesday’s match. 

The Dragons are justified in their posting as favourites ($1.43 vs $2.85); they’ve won the past 3 at home against the Tigers and have an edge in attack (average 18ppg vs 15ppg). They will need to be better defensively though (25ppg vs 24ppg) where the Tigers will try to drag them into an ‘arm wrestle’ style of a match. The line (7.5) is set far too high when you consider the averages of each side. If you are planning on investing in this market, keep your options lower (see SGM). 

The average winning margin in their past 5 games sits at 7.2 points, with just one win by a 13+ margin. Given the expected wet conditions in Wollongong, this could be similar outcome. The Dragons are the preferred choice but are to be avoided, as other option are more enticing. With the average total points sitting at 40 in their past 5 matches and a poor attack record of each, the total points on offer appears to be the ideal selection.
